    Number Format

    Hello all. In the excel i attach there is a number which corresponds to a duration in seconds. For instance Cell A2 is a 30 second duration shown as 30:01:00 where 30 corresponds to seconds and 01 corresponds to milliseconds.
    I would like to write a formula that will sum the duration in Cell B16 in min format. For instance in this case the sum of seconds is 338.5. How can i make it show the sum as 5 mins, 38 seconds and 5 milliseconds.

    Re: Number Format

    What you are showing is 30 hours and 1 minute. You'd need to divide by 3600 (60 * 60) to reduce that down to seconds. Then use Custom Format ss.000.

    full duration format is: d.hh:mm:ss.ff
    • d: Number of days.
    • hh: Number of hours, between 0 and 23.
    • mm: Number of minutes, between 0 and 59.
    • ss: Number of seconds, between 0 and 59.
    • ff: Fraction of seconds, between 0 and 9999999
